DNF不能双开?深度解析原因与高效多开解决方案
对于许多《地下城与勇士》(DNF)的忠实玩家而言,同时运行多个游戏账号进行搬砖、带小号或管理公会事务是日常需求。然而,许多玩家在尝试双开时都会遇到一个令人头疼的问题:DNF不能双开。这背后究竟是游戏官方的限制,还是系统兼容性问题?本文将为你深度解析DNF无法双开的根本原因,并提供一系列经过验证的、安全高效的解决方案,帮助你突破限制,实现流畅的多开体验。
一、 为何DNF官方会限制或导致无法双开?
首先,我们需要理解DNF在设计上对多开不友好甚至限制的原因。首要因素是反作弊与公平性考量。DNF作为一款拥有经济系统和PVP竞技元素的游戏,官方通过技术手段限制同一台电脑上同时运行多个客户端,旨在打击工作室利用大量账号自动化“搬砖”破坏游戏经济平衡,以及防止在PK场等场景下进行恶意匹配操控行为。其次,是出于客户端稳定性与性能优化的考虑。DNF客户端本身对系统资源(尤其是CPU和内存)占用较高,同时运行多个实例极易导致程序崩溃、闪退或整体系统卡顿,影响所有账号的游戏体验。因此,游戏程序本身往往带有检测机制,阻止第二个及以上的客户端启动。

二、 常见“DNF不能双开”的错误提示与原因分析
当玩家尝试双开时,通常会遇到以下几种情况:1. 直接启动失败:启动第二个客户端时毫无反应,或弹出未知错误提示框。这通常是游戏主程序(DNF.exe)的自我保护机制被触发。2. “游戏正在运行”提示:系统检测到已有DNF进程,禁止再次启动。这涉及到进程互斥锁(Mutex)技术。3. 运行时冲突与闪退:即使成功启动了两个客户端,在切换角色、进入副本时也极易发生其中一个甚至两个客户端崩溃。这多源于内存地址冲突或图形渲染资源争夺。理解这些现象背后的技术原理,是寻找正确解决方法的第一步。
三、 安全可靠的DNF双开与多开方法全攻略
尽管有官方限制,但玩家社区依然探索出了多种相对稳定可行的多开方法,主要分为以下几类:
1. 利用虚拟机(VM)技术: 这是从原理上最彻底的方法。通过在电脑上安装如VMware、VirtualBox等虚拟机软件,创建一个独立的虚拟Windows系统。在这个虚拟系统中单独安装并运行DNF,与主机系统完全隔离,从而实现真正的双开甚至多开。此方法的优点是稳定性高,几乎不会被检测;缺点是对电脑硬件(尤其是内存和CPU)要求极高,且设置过程较为复杂。
2. 使用沙盒(Sandbox)软件: 沙盒是一种轻量级的虚拟化环境。使用像Sandboxie这样的软件,可以将第二个DNF客户端运行在一个沙盒隔离空间中,使其与原始客户端进程互不干扰。这种方法比虚拟机更节省资源,设置相对简单,是许多玩家的首选。但需要注意,使用任何第三方软件都存在一定的账号安全风险,务必从官方可信渠道下载软件。
3. 修改系统用户与进程隔离(适用于部分系统): 在Windows系统中,通过快速切换用户(非注销),在不同用户账户下分别运行DNF客户端,有时可以绕过检测。更进阶的方法是使用“进程隔离”工具或脚本,修改第二个客户端进程的识别信息,欺骗游戏的单实例检测机制。这种方法技术要求高,且随着游戏更新可能失效。
四、 多开时的优化设置与注意事项
成功实现双开只是第一步,保证流畅运行同样关键。首先,进行游戏内设置优化:将所有客户端的游戏画质调至最低,关闭音效、特效和垂直同步,可以极大减轻GPU和CPU负担。其次,优化系统资源分配:通过任务管理器,为不同的DNF进程设置不同的CPU核心关联性(Affinity),并确保有充足的可用内存(建议16GB或以上)。最后,也是最重要的安全警告:绝对不要使用来路不明的所谓“一键多开外挂”或修改游戏客户端文件,这极有可能携带木马病毒,导致账号被盗,或因为篡改游戏文件而遭到官方封号处罚。安全永远是第一位的。
五、 总结与最终建议
总而言之,“DNF不能双开”主要是由游戏官方的反作弊策略和客户端技术架构决定的。虽然存在限制,但通过虚拟机、沙盒等合法技术手段,玩家依然可以在保障账号安全的前提下实现多开需求。对于大多数普通玩家,我们推荐尝试沙盒方案,它在易用性、资源消耗和效果之间取得了较好的平衡。在操作前,请务必备份好系统或重要数据。同时,请合理规划游戏时间,多开虽然能提升效率,但也应享受游戏本身的乐趣。希望本文能帮助你解决DNF多开的难题,在阿拉德大陆的冒险更加顺畅自如。
